Pls I need to understand why I was denied a B1/B2.
Work in multinational with very good salary
Interview goes thus-

Consular: Hello y are u going to the US
Me: For tourism basically
Consular: Where are you going?
Me: Atlanta
Consular: Why Atlanta
Me: I heard there are a lot tourist attractions there like CNN, Coca cola.
Consular: What do You do for a living?
Me: Told him where I work
Consular: What do u do exactly?
Me: Gave him a brief description of my work
Consular: What's your salary monthly
Me : Its 302,.....i don't have the other figure in my head its 302k with some hundreds
Consular: You travelled to turkey,y?
Me: Went to visit my dad there
Consular:what does he do in turkey
Me: Told him
Consular: Why is he back in the country?
Me: ( at this point o was why he was asking about this,so I didn't answer outrightly) he's sick right now n in the country
Consular: Oh sorry about that what does he have
Me: Stroke but he's recovering now. Thank you
Consular: Are u married?
Me: No
Consular: Have u ever been to any other country.
Me: Yes, Dubai
Consular: I'm sorry but I don't think u eligible to go to the US now maybe some other time.

He didn't ask for any document.

So pls what went wrong trying to figure that out. Thanks
Note: I was completely honest with all my response.
